文档介绍:基于虚拟仪器的分布式速度检测系统设计
目录
1 引言 1
速度检测系统研究的背景和意义 1
虚拟仪器技术介绍 2
虚拟仪器技术在速度检测系统设计中的应用 3
2 系统总体设计 3
分布式速度检测系统的基本原理 4
系统软硬件设计方法 4
系统数据采集方案 4
操作面板的设计 5
系统抗干扰设计 5
3 分布式速度检测系统的硬件结构 6
计算机的选择 7
数据采集系统 7
传感器装置 8
信号处理电路 9
信息传输电路 10
到位检测及传感器控制电路 11
4 分布式速度检测系统的软件设计 11
速度检测系统检测流程 11
系统软件结构 13
到位信号检测模块 13
数据采集模块 14
数据计算处理模块 14
数据存储模块 14
网络通信模块 15
5 系统调试 16
6 结束语 17
参考文献 18
附录1 系统主程序框图 19
附录2 数据采集模块程序框图 20
附录3 数据计算处理与数据存储模块程序框图 21
附录4 网络通信模块程序框图 22
致谢 24
摘要:本文提出了一种基于虚拟仪器的分布式速度检测系统方案,实现了对较大范围内物体运动速度的实时跟踪检测。本系统的设计思路主要是通过记录物体在一段较短距离内的运动时间来计算出物体在该段路程中的平均速度,并把这个平均速度近似看做物体运动的即时速度。将若干个这样的短距离中的平均速度描点、连线,绘制出速度曲线,并以此来表现出物体的运动情况。针对速度检测信息量大的特点,本系统采用虚拟仪器技术建立一个数据存储、处理和显示平台,将速度数据实时显示在显示屏幕上,达到实时监测的目的,同时还可以远离现场进行远程监控。
关键字:虚拟仪器;LabVIEW;速度检测;分布式系统
Distributed Speed Detection System Based on Virtual Instrument
Abstract: A design of distributed speed detection system based on virtual instrument ,which is able to detect an object's speed in paratively wide scale, is carried out in this paper. By recording moving time of the object in a short distance, the average velocity, which is regarded as an instant velocity of the object, is easy to be calculated. With many of those average velocities, it is able to draw a velocity curve to show movement of the object. That is how the system is designed. Because of the great deal of information during speed detection, virtual instrument technology is used in this system to create a platform to store, process and display data. The real-time speed of the object is shown in the screen to make a real-time monitoring. It is also capable of remote detection, being far away from industrial field.
Keywords: Virtual Instrument; Labview; Speed Detection; Distributed system
1 引言
速度检测系统研究的背景和意义
随着机械化大生产的发展,对运动物体的速度进行检测始终是工业生产领域的一个重要话题。特别是随着流水线工艺在工业生产中的广泛应用,在较大范围内对移动工件进行实时速度检测逐渐成为了生产过程中必不可少的一个环节。目前,国内外对物体运动速度的检测大致存在两种方法:一种是测量物体的平均速度,如公路运输系